Block 340,890
Block Hash
35343217f66d514bc9e960294aedeb196bc6f31cd5e804f1069caf83ffaf06ed
Previous Block Hash
c3632ad489a264902b384b19d702a164eff77233242ab54c7d8fb7e3a2ba13f5
Mined
Transactions
4
Difficulty
19.44 M
Size
3,653 bytes
Transactions (4)
1 input, 1 output
62,500.0552
PEPE
20 inputs, 1 output
4,434,144.25061481
PEPE
1 input, 3 outputs
62,499.9974
PEPE
1 input, 2 outputs
1,073,142.57003101
PEPE